KraneShares MSCI Market Risk Analysis
Today, many novice investors tend to focus exclusively on investment returns with little concern for KraneShares MSCI's investment risk. Standard deviation is the most common way to measure market volatility of etfs, such as KraneShares MSCI All, and traders can use it to determine the average amount a KraneShares MSCI's price has deviated from the expected return over a period of time. It is calculated by determining the expected price for the established period and then subtracting this figure from each price point. The differences are then squared, summed, and averaged to produce the variance.

The market value of KraneShares MSCI All is measured differently than its book value, which is the value of KraneShares that is recorded on the company's balance sheet. Investors also form their own opinion of KraneShares MSCI's value that differs from its market value or its book value, called intrinsic value, which is KraneShares MSCI's true underlying value. Investors use various methods to calculate intrinsic value and buy a stock when its market value falls below its intrinsic value. Because KraneShares MSCI's market value can be influenced by many factors that don't directly affect KraneShares MSCI's underlying business (such as a pandemic or basic market pessimism), market value can vary widely from intrinsic value.
Please note, there is a significant difference between KraneShares MSCI's value and its price as these two are different measures arrived at by different means. Investors typically determine if KraneShares MSCI is a good investment by looking at such factors as earnings, sales, fundamental and technical indicators, competition as well as analyst projections. However, KraneShares MSCI's price is the amount at which it trades on the open market and represents the number that a seller and buyer find agreeable to each party.
